Full Filmography
Every movie Jérémie Petrus has appeared in, with audience ratings and verdicts.
| Year | Movie | Character | Success | More |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| Monsieur Aznavour | Franck Riesner | Hit | Similar → |
| 2023 | Betty's Burning | - | Flop | Similar → |
| 2023 | Bac +12 | Christophe | Flop | Similar → |
| 2022 | Binaud & Claude | Policier | Flop | Similar → |
| 2021 | Eiffel | Edmond | Average | Similar → |
| 2020 | Working Girls | Hotel man | Flop | Similar → |
| 2018 | Vihta | Kévin | Average | Similar → |
| 2016 | Fanny's Journey | Julien | Hit | Similar → |
| 2015 | The Well | - | Average | Similar → |
| 2013 | The Miracle of Life | Francis | Flop | Similar → |
| 2012 | My Way | Claude's friend | Average | Similar → |
| 2010 | Martha | Thomas | Flop | Similar → |
